While they're all the same bean botanically, butter beans have different names depending on the region. In the South and in the United Kingdom, they're typically referred to as butter beans. Elsewhere in the U.S., they're known as lima beans (named for Lima, Peru, the bean's point of origin).

WebLima beans are larger and firmer than edamame, with a starchy taste. Comparatively, edamame are smaller and softer, with a sweet flavor. As a result, lima beans are usually cooked thoroughly before being consumed, while edamame are commonly eaten raw or cooked lightly to avoid becoming mushy. Weblima bean: [noun] a bushy or vining tropical American bean (Phaseolus lunatus synonym Phaseolus limensis) that is widely cultivated for its flat edible starchy seed which is usually pale green when immature and whitish or beige when mature.

Web4 jan. 2024 · The Fordhook lima bean is one of the all-time favorites for commercial lima bean growers in the country. It has been around for decades and first saw popularity in the mid-1940s. This bean, also known as the Butter Bean, can grow on a bush or pole, depending on your preferences.
